Handover: GridSmith crossword generator. Ownership moves from Priya's squad to platform. Service builds daily puzzles from the Lexora word bank; cron fires at 03:00. Known issue: symmetry checker occasionally rejects valid grids — retry once before paging. Logs live in the usual aggregator under gridsmith-prod. New folks: read the grid-fill doc first. The current production configuration values are listed below.

deployment values, yadug-bawif:
[framir]
team = pelox
access_code = ac_a38ab2
owner = tamion.julael
host = framir.tolvaqlabs.test
port = 11211
peer = tammir.zemvargrid.local
salt = 2215ef03
pin = 1541

Handover — reception, Tolvane House. Canteen on level 2 now opens to Brennick & Moss staff weekdays 11:30–14:00. Their people sign in at our desk first, no exceptions. Lanyards stay visible. If the shared door on the canteen corridor locks out, don't call facilities straight away — it resets itself after five minutes. Queries about billing go to Marta on catering, not us. For letting Brennick visitors through the canteen corridor door, use the pass code below.

staff pass of kawip-hawef = bdg-QLP-2

## Formula sandbox tuning

User-supplied formulas in Gridmoor execute inside a restricted interpreter with hard ceilings on time, memory, and call depth. Reviewers should confirm any change to these ceilings is justified in the PR description, since raising them widens the abuse surface. Defaults were chosen from production traces. The current limits are as follows.

limits module of tafog-fawip:
WEIGHTS = {
    "julix": 57,
    "lamys": 992,
    "kasvan": 209,
    "quenok": 750,
    "alddor": 259,
    "oliath": 1009,
    "wenix": 815,
}

Minutes — Management Meeting, Brindlecote Holdings

Attendees: regional leadership and branch managers. Main agenda item: renewal of the group property and liability policy with Aldermoor Mutual. Premiums rise 11% owing to last winter's claims at the Fennick depot. Managers agreed to tighter incident reporting and a revised deductible structure. Renewal paperwork must be countersigned by month-end. Action items circulated separately. The chair closed with a confidential note on forward plans, recorded below.

confidential, kagep-kahof: Druokax Systems plans to lower the Ulaath list price by 53 percent in March.